OPA725AIDBVT Description

OPA725AIDBVT Description

The OPA725AIDBVT is a high-performance general-purpose operational amplifier (op-amp) from Texas Instruments, designed for a wide range of applications requiring precision and high-speed performance. This op-amp is housed in a compact SOT23-5 package, making it suitable for surface-mount applications where space is a critical consideration. The OPA725AIDBVT features a maximum supply voltage span of 12 V and a minimum supply voltage span of 4 V, providing flexibility in power supply requirements. It boasts a gain bandwidth product of 20 MHz and a high slew rate of 30 V/µs, ensuring fast response times and minimal signal distortion. The op-amp is designed to operate with a supply current of 4.3 mA, making it energy-efficient for various applications. Additionally, the OPA725AIDBVT offers a low input bias current of 30 pA and an input offset voltage of 1.2 mV, contributing to its precision performance.

OPA725AIDBVT Features

  • High Gain Bandwidth Product: The 20 MHz gain bandwidth product ensures that the OPA725AIDBVT can handle high-frequency signals with minimal phase shift and distortion, making it suitable for applications requiring wide bandwidth and fast transient response.
  • High Slew Rate: The 30 V/µs slew rate allows the op-amp to quickly respond to changes in input signals, reducing settling time and improving overall system performance.
  • Low Input Bias Current: The low input bias current of 30 pA minimizes the loading effect on the input signal source, preserving signal integrity and ensuring accurate amplification.
  • Low Input Offset Voltage: The 1.2 mV input offset voltage ensures high precision in signal amplification, making the OPA725AIDBVT ideal for applications where accuracy is paramount.
  • Wide Supply Voltage Range: With a supply voltage range of 4 V to 12 V, the OPA725AIDBVT can be used in a variety of power supply configurations, providing flexibility in system design.
  • Energy Efficiency: The op-amp operates with a supply current of 4.3 mA, making it suitable for applications where power consumption is a concern.
  • Compact Packaging: The SOT23-5 package is ideal for surface-mount applications, offering a small footprint and ease of integration into compact electronic designs.
  • Compliance and Reliability: The OPA725AIDBVT is REACH unaffected and RoHS3 compliant, ensuring environmental sustainability and regulatory compliance. It also has a moisture sensitivity level (MSL) of 2 (1 Year), enhancing its reliability in various environmental conditions.
